For Ghana traders, trading costs are crucial because even small spreads can eat into profits over time. HotForex HFM offers spreads from 0.0 pips on its Zero account with a small commission, while the Premium account has spreads from 1.2 pips with no commission. Moneta Markets uses fixed spreads, starting at 1.0 pips on its Standard account without commission. For high-volume traders (e.g., 10+ lots per month), HotForex HFM's variable spreads reduce costs significantly, especially during London and New York sessions when Ghana's trading hours overlap. Moneta Markets' fixed spreads provide stability but are higher on average. Additionally, HotForex HFM offers a 50% bonus on deposits for Ghana accounts under certain conditions, further lowering effective costs. Overall, traders focused on minimizing expenses will prefer HotForex HFM.

Regulation is a top priority for Ghana traders, as the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) Ghana does not directly license foreign brokers. HotForex HFM is regulated by CySEC (Cyprus), FCA (UK), and FSCA (South Africa), providing strong investor protection and negative balance protection. Moneta Markets is regulated by the FSCA in South Africa and also holds an offshore license from St. Vincent and the Grenadines (SVG), which offers limited oversight. For Ghana traders, HotForex HFM's Tier-1 regulation means funds are segregated in top-tier banks and traders can access compensation schemes (up to €20,000 under CySEC). Moneta Markets' FSCA regulation is adequate but not as robust. While both brokers accept Ghana clients, HotForex HFM's stricter regulatory framework offers greater peace of mind for mobile-first traders depositing via MTN MoMo.

Ghana traders benefit from multiple local deposit and withdrawal options at both brokers. HotForex HFM supports MTN MoMo, Vodafone Cash, and Bank Transfer with a minimum deposit of $5 (approx. 60 GHS) and zero deposit fees. Moneta Markets also accepts MTN MoMo, Vodafone Cash, and Bank Transfer but requires a higher minimum deposit of $50 (approx. 600 GHS). For withdrawals, HotForex HFM processes mobile money requests within 24 hours, while bank transfers take 1-2 business days. Moneta Markets processes withdrawals within 1-3 business days, with no fees for mobile money. Both brokers allow withdrawals back to the same payment method used for deposit. HotForex HFM's lower minimum deposit makes it more accessible for Ghana traders starting with small capital. Always verify daily transaction limits with your mobile money provider to avoid delays.

Both HotForex HFM and Moneta Markets off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ts for Ghanaian Muslim traders who require Sharia-compliant trading. HotForex HFM provides swap-free accounts on its Premium and Zero accounts, but not on the Pro account; traders must request activation via customer support and maintain a minimum trading volume to keep the status. Moneta Markets offers a dedicated Islamic account option that is automatically swap-free with no additional conditions. Given Ghana's significant Muslim population, both brokers ensure that overnight interest is not charged or credited. Traders should note that some instruments may still incur holding costs or require specific settings. For Ghana Muslims, Moneta Markets' straightforward Islamic account may be more convenient, while HotForex HFM offers more flexibility across account types.
